- Truck Dispatch Services Cover Multitasks for Product Delivery
Delivering a product from inventory to the customer’s door is a task that involves many tasks. It seems simple and easy, but it involves different tasks and challenges, e.g., loading, selection of route, proper vehicle, selection of height and width of the vehicle according to the load, vehicle maintenance, weather conditions, knowing rules and regulations of the state regarding transportation, communication with customers and at the end unloading at the customer’s side.
All these points are necessary to proceed for a quick and efficient delivery. A company owner cannot manage these all on his own. A skilled team with expertise in the dispatching field is essential. When you hire truck dispatching services for the delivery process, they perform all these tasks for a smooth delivery.

Dispatchers Provide Logistics Optimization Solutions
Many logistical problems arise in deliveries. Different states have different rules for truck dispatching services.
The most common looks are:
Height and width of the truck
Weight of load on the truck
Road conditions, like any construction on the designated route
Weather forecast during the delivery period
Assigning deliveries to truck dispatchers frees you from all the above-mentioned problems. Your job is only to address your dispatcher about your load weight, delivery time, and customer address. The rest is the duty of dispatchers.

Continuous Vehicle Tracking.
Truck dispatchers have different software and tools to logistic tracking vehicles. They Continuously track the vehicles and remain in contact with the customers and drivers. This is helpful for multiple deliveries on the same journey. It is also helpful at the time of any natural disaster.
Suppose you have a commitment with your customer for a delivery time, and your driver gets stuck on the road due to some natural climate change, and the weather is good on your customer’s side. How will you and your customer know the reason for the delayed delivery of the order? These vehicle logistic tracking system tools help a lot to avoid this inconvenience.
